1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the GCF of 18k and 15k³?

Back

3k

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Factor out a GCF: 2n² - 8n³

Back

2n²(1 - 4n)

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Factor out a GCF: 4b⁵ + 4b³ + 16b²

Back

4b²(b³ + b + 4)

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Factor out a GCF: 6m² + 16m

Back

2m(3m + 8)

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the greatest factor of 28 and 49?

Back

7

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Define GCF (Greatest Common Factor).

Back

The largest positive integer that divides each of the given integers without leaving a remainder.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you find the GCF of two numbers?

Back

List the factors of each number and identify the largest factor they have in common.
